Second Lt. Amanda LaSarge, platoon leader, Company A, 204th Brigade Support Battalion, 2nd Brigade Combat Team, 4th Infantry Division, takes cover behind a pallet during a paintball game at Turkey Creek, Sept. 28, 2012. The paintball game is an event sponsored by the Warrior Adventure Quest program for redeploying Soldiers as a way to help with reintegration. The purpose of WAQ is to let soldiers participate in extreme sports as a positive way of generating the same type of adrenaline they may have felt while deployed.
